CUDAArgMinList

CUDAArgMinList[list]

gives the index of the minimum element in list.

Details and Options

  • The CUDALink application must be loaded using Needs["CUDALink`"].
  • CUDAArgMinList finds the first index that minimizes absolute value.
  • CUDAArgMinList works only on vectors.
  • CUDAArgMinList does not work on vector types.

Possible Issues  (1)

CUDAArgMinList does not work with negative inputs, since CUDAArgMinList finds the element with the lowest absolute value:
